The two aluminium extrusions are separated from each other by the polyamide strips. This allows the inside and outside of these types of profiles to have different colours. In addition, polyamide has a very good dimensional stability owing to its extremely small expansion coefficient. Polyamide is specifically resistant to very high and very low temperatures. The insertion of the strips therefore has no effect on the structural strength and durability of your window profiles. All this ensures that thermal break profiles offer almost unlimited possibilities in terms of aesthetics and design.
